What Is The Noco Boost HD?
The NOCO Boost HD is a high-capacity lithium jump starter designed to safely start vehicles with dead batteries, including cars, trucks, and boats. Utilizing lithium iron phosphate (LiFePO4) chemistry, it delivers 2000-3000A peak current while integrating spark-proof technology, reverse polarity protection, and USB-C charging. Compact and portable, it supports 12V systems and doubles as a power bank for devices. Pro Tip: Store at 50% charge if unused for months to preserve battery health.

What defines the NOCO Boost HD?
The NOCO Boost HD combines LiFePO4 battery technology with ultra-safe circuitry, offering up to 40 jump starts per charge. Its rugged design operates in -40°F to 140°F, with built-in thermal sensors preventing overloads. Pro Tip: Always pre-charge the unit every 3 months to avoid deep discharge cycles.
At its core, the Boost HD uses a 12V LiFePO4 battery with a 2000A (GBX1555 model) to 3000A (GBX155) peak output. The multi-stage protection system includes short-circuit detection and automatic shutdown if voltage exceeds 14.7V. Practically speaking, this means you can safely jump-start a diesel truck without worrying about sparks near the battery terminals. For example, the GBX155 model can crank a 7.0L gasoline engine up to 20 times on a single charge. Pro Tip: Use the built-in LED flashlight during emergencies—it doubles as an SOS beacon.

How does the NOCO Boost HD work?
The device uses smart voltage sensing to detect 12V battery status, activating only when clamps are properly connected. A microprocessor manages current flow to prevent overloading the vehicle’s ECU. Pro Tip: Clean battery terminals before attaching clamps—corrosion increases resistance by 30-50%.
When you connect the clamps, the Boost HD’s BoostTech algorithm assesses the vehicle’s power needs. If the battery voltage is below 2V (fully dead), it initiates a “force mode” to bypass safety protocols—though this should only be done as a last resort. Think of it like an adrenaline shot for your car’s electrical system. But what happens if you reverse the clamps? The built-in Reverse Polarity Protection instantly disables output and flashes a warning light. Transitionally, this eliminates the risk of frying your alternator or fuses.

What safety features does it include?
Key safeguards include spark-proof clamps, over-voltage rollback, and a flame-retardant ABS case. The X-Connect clamp system ensures 300% better conductivity than standard alligator clips. Pro Tip: Avoid exposing the unit to direct sunlight for extended periods—UV rays degrade the LCD screen.
Beyond basic protections, the Boost HD employs dynamic load detection. When you connect it to a battery, it measures internal resistance to determine if the clamps are attached to a valid 12V system. This prevents accidental activation, say, if the clamps touch metal tools in your trunk. For instance, attempting to jump-start a 24V military truck would trigger an error code (E02). Transitionally, this granular control is why NOCO units have a 0.001% failure rate in third-party tests. Pro Tip: Update firmware via USB-C annually—new safety algorithms get added regularly.
